Output f51fbec96b60e06599a9e8fbdac5f1c23e247c73e36048e6330e4f9336d350f6:5

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d776933560abdb5c5f52614d77e63a639afb9504 OP_EQUALVERIFY OP_CHECKSIG
address
DQnMsErgX8oYJ7p9nVQvVjuthausQ3gA8p
transaction
f51fbec96b60e06599a9e8fbdac5f1c23e247c73e36048e6330e4f9336d350f6